National Occupational Standards for Pensions

The FSSC, in conjunction with employers, trade associations and awarding bodies, has developed National Occupational Standards for those working in pensions.

The following suites have now been approved and may be downloaded here.


 

Providing advice on savings for retirement

SFR 1 - Engage with the customer and establish reasons for seeking advice on savings for retirement
SFR 2 - Establish the customer’s key savings for retirement needs
SFR 3 - Identify ways of meeting savings for retirement needs for the customer to consider
SFR 4 - Identify and agree priorities and options for the customer to enable informed pension choices
SFR 5 - Review and present information to provide advice on savings for retirement
SFR 6 - Refer the customer to further information or advice on savings for retirement

Pension trustee board secretaryship

PTS 1 - Contribute to the effective functioning of the Board of Trustees
PTS 2 - Contribute to the pension fund’s strategy and structure
PTS 3 - Provide secretarial services at Trustee meetings
PTS 4 - Draft and maintain a Trustee manual
PTS 5 - Co-ordinate communication and liaison between relevant parties
PTS 6 - Manage and monitor contracts
PTS 7 - Advise Trustees
